Traffic diversions issued in Mumbai from Wednesday (17 January) due to closure of Sion Road bridge

Risk level: Low Country: India

As per reports, the Mumbai Traffic Police has issued diversions from Wednesday (17 January) due to the closure of the Sion Road over Bridge (RoB), which primarily joins the eastern and the western suburbs. Traffic wardens will be deployed at all the routes where the traffic of Sion RoB is expected.

The three main diversion routes the motorists can opt for instead of Sion RoB to reach their destinations are:

• Santacruz-Chembur Link Road via Kurla, which joins the Eastern Express Highway.
• Sion Hospital road via the Sulochana Shetty Marg that connects to Dr BA Road to Kumbharwada in Dharavi.
• Chunabhatti-Bandra Kurla Complex Connector (no two-wheelers and three-wheelers allowed).
